IMS student member Steven T. Moen, PhD student at the University of Wisconsin, won the ASA John J. Bartko Scholarship Award to attend the Conference on Statistical Practice (which was virtual this year, in February). Steven decided to study economics in college but especially the models and systems used in the field, which led him to statistics. His focus is on financial statistics and studying the theoretical aspects of time-dependent data. Currently, Moen is collaborating with Russell Green, a senior economist at the International Monetary Fund, on a paper about the market microstructure of India’s sovereign bond market, which could help prevent another currency crisis.
